The duet occurs in Act I on the island of Ceylon (modern-day Sri Lanka). Two old friends, Nadir (tenor) and Zurga (baritone), reunite after years apart. They recall a shared past where they both fell in love with the same beautiful priestess, Leila, at a temple in Kandy.
